Output efbf514c889b5968f953992772d16d15d6121e2bc9d506557da4d2436d80f255:21

value
89443198126
script pubkey
OP_0 OP_PUSHBYTES_20 85980188f4070c294bc68e511843248f6823c15f
address
tb1qskvqrz85quxzjj7x3eg3ssey3a5z8s2ldj4w0n
transaction
efbf514c889b5968f953992772d16d15d6121e2bc9d506557da4d2436d80f255
confirmations
2455
spent
true